Working in pairs, one player sets the ball to the their partner who moves to meet the ball using good footwork to bump the ball back to their partner who catches the ball.
Ensure the player bumping the ball lets the ball bounce on their wrists and only makes minor adjustments to give direction to the ball (back to the setter).
The setter shouldn't have to move to receive the return pass, only the player digging the ball should move to get themselves in a position where they can get under the ball.
Players must perform this skill 5 times before swapping roles.
Progression:
Players can try to perform this skill continuously, without catching the ball.
